Quintero Brevas (3)

Quintero Brevas (3)

The Quintero Brevas (3) represents an accessible entry point into the world of Cuban cigars, offering enthusiasts a handmade experience at a modest price point. Released in approximately 2002, this vitola has maintained its place in regular production, serving as a reliable everyday smoke for those who appreciate traditional Cuban flavors without the premium associated with long-filler counterparts.

Specifications

Quintero Brevas (3)
Cigar NameBrevas (3)
Factory NameNacionales
Ring Gauge40
Length140 mm (5½″)
Official Weight8.28 g
ConstructionHandmade, short-filler tobacco
BandsStandard band A, B
PackagingCardboard box of 25 aluminium foil bundled cigars
StatusCurrent (Released c.2002)

Construction and Presentation

Quintero Brevas (3) packaging

As a handmade short-filler cigar, the Brevas (3) utilizes smaller pieces of tobacco leaf in its filler blend, while maintaining proper whole leaves for the binder and wrapper. This construction method allows for a more affordable product while still delivering authentic Cuban character. The cigars are presented in cardboard boxes containing 25 units, each individually protected within aluminium foil bundles to preserve freshness and flavor integrity.

The cigar features the standard Quintero band configuration, incorporating both band A and band B in its presentation.

Flavor Profile

Quintero Brevas (3) packaging

Smokers can expect a straightforward flavor profile dominated by earthy and natural tobacco characteristics. The Brevas (3) delivers prominent notes of hay, leather, and wood, which form the core of its taste experience. Secondary flavors include cedar, baking spice, and grass, adding subtle dimension to the smoke.

More delicate nuances emerge occasionally, with hints of chocolate, cocoa, dried green herbs, floral elements, fruit, light wood, and smoke appearing throughout the smoking experience. These supporting notes provide occasional complexity without overwhelming the primary flavor foundation.

Related Releases

Collectors should note that two other Brevas variants have existed within the Quintero lineup. The Brevas (1) was a handmade version that has since been discontinued, while the Brevas (2) was a machine-made offering that is also no longer in production. The Brevas (3) remains the sole surviving representative of this name format in the current Quintero portfolio.
